Road grading is a crucial maintenance process for ensuring the smooth and safe functioning of roads. It involves leveling and smoothing the surface of the road, removing potholes, bumps, and other irregularities. The benefits of road grading are numerous. Firstly, it enhances road safety by reducing the risk of accidents caused by uneven surfaces. By creating a smooth driving experience, road grading also minimizes wear and tear on vehicles, leading to lower maintenance costs for drivers. Additionally, road grading improves drainage, preventing water accumulation and reducing the chances of flooding. This process also helps extend the lifespan of the road, saving municipalities and governments significant amounts of money in the long run. Overall, road grading is an essential practice that contributes to safer, more efficient, and cost-effective transportation systems.
